Take Paradise City.

Bumble's solo is going to be reminiscent of Bucket's solo...which was itself a rearrangement of Slash's version. In a way it's like this line up covers the arrangements of the 2002 era line up.

Then it's compounded by Axl's voice having problems and the emphasis on the old material.

Ideally we'd get totally new music...but to me the band comes alive even on the CD era tracks....at least it sure gets my interest a lot more...I'd rather hear Shackler, Twat, Prostitute, IRS etc than UYI or AFD tracks from them. At least the CD era tracks are designed for a form of the modern band...even if DJ is the new robin....

Cos the problem with AFD tracks is it's not the AFD band, it's not the UYI era band, it's not the 2002 era band, it's like the 5th generation or something of the band playing but they're always playing gen 1 songs.

And those songs didn't have pitman parts or 8 people in the band or whatever...so at best you're getting these giant 2002 era orchestrations of the songs...which were themselves covers....and then the only surviving link to the thing they are replicating is Axl....and his voice is not in form at the moment....so it becomes odd to hear band version 5 with Axl at 1/3 his normal ability performing songs recorded 30 years ago...
